The author, then aged 24, seated in the Mew Gull at Gravesend in February 1939. Note how close the instrument panel is to the pilot's face. The panel was moved backwards in order to accommodate a larger fuel tank.

Two photographs of the author taken immediately after landing at the Cape. All records have been broken, but he is now faced with the return flight a little more than 27hr later. Having landed at Cape Town at 1859hr on the Monday evening he took off again for the first return stage at 2218hr the following day.

Another refuelling stop on the outbound journey, this time at Mossamedes. The author is splattered with blood from a torn finger snagged on a small retaining hook on a side window.
